Impact of the COVID-19 Pandemic on theWorld Steel Market

The article analyzes the activities of steel companies during the COVID-19 pandemic in 2020. The COVID-19 pandemic and the subsequent economic crisis have become one of the most serious challenges for world steel companies. The consequences, which are expressed in a decrease in demand for steel products from the key consumer sectors—automotive industry and construction, and other consumers, have caused a high level of uncertainty in the international steel market, and have identified new development vectors that should help overcome the crisis in the steel industry. The article assesses the impact of the pandemic and current global economic crisis on the global steel industry, including Russia; identifies trends and prospects for the development of the global steel market; identifies key areas for the recovery of the steel industry after the COVID-19 pandemic. © The Editor(s) (if applicable) and The Author(s), under exclusive license to Springer Nature Switzerland AG 2022.
